| Worn to: - Midlands MCM Expo 13th September 2008 I love Yoshitaka Amano's artwork, and think that his drawings of Aerith are especially beautiful. I've wanted to do this costume for quite a while, now, and after finding the perfect material in the fabric shop (although I was looking for material for my Crisis Core Aerith cosplay!), I snapped it up instantly. After a crisis of "oh crap, I haven't got enough of this fabric!!", I managed to resolve it by using another large piece that I found when I got home. :) I really enjoyed working on this costume; I wanted it to be rather elegant and so that's why I used posh-looking material. Normally, the pink satin would have been £10.21 a metre, but it was on sale and I was able to pay a lot less for it! :D I was told that satin is a bitch to work with, but I found that it glided through my machine perfectly and I am so happy with how it turned out. <3 The red velvet was also lovely to work with, although I had to ask my mother for help with the sleeves, as I wasn't sure how to make them poofy. Fortunately, she's an experienced seamstress, so she helped me with them and they were finished rather quickly. ^_^ The beading work was a lot easier than it looks; some of it was bought from the shop for me to sew on, and so of the beads and sequins were ones that I had lying around at home. The bracelets were bought (I would have liked to have made my own, but I ran out of time and I thought these were rather suitable, and the wig and necklace were the same that I've used for my other Aeris costumes. The shoes were a pair that I bought ages and ages ago for the sole purpose of doing this cosplay; when I saw them, I knew they were suitable and just had to have them! Finally, I made the matching bag out of some left over satin. I thought that if I wore this dress and carried around a satchel like I normally do, I'd look rather...silly. So, I decided to make the bag for my phone and purse, and other convention essentials! | |
